General Safety Warnings

Avoid accidental starting of engine while servicing; twist and remove all spark plug leadsWhen using shop air for cleaning or drying parts: Be sure air supply is regulated to not more than 25 psi (172 kPa) Be sure you use appropriate eye protection to avoid personal injuryReplace any locking fastener (locknut or patch screw) if its locking feature becomes weakDefinite resistance to tightening must be felt when reusing locking fastenerIf replacement is indicated, use only authorized replacement or equivalentUnder some full tilt conditions, or periods where the engine's gearcase is removed, the trimtilt unit could be out of sequence, not fully supporting the engine's weightEngine might drop unexpectedly to its trimmed out positionAvoid personal injury; always support the engine's weight with suitable hoist or the trailering arms during serviceRefer to Safety Section, Parts and B, for additional safety considerations
